I am trying to get the nodes from my opc server and when I am reading them back, I get a warning called, "The node id refers to a node that does not exist in the server address space". The Identifier type is GUID. I used opcuanode function to get the nodes. I am forever gratefull if someone could show me my mistake. Please have a look at the attached pictures for more informations. I got the same problem when I was trying to crawl automatically a server and gather all wanted information about the existing nodes.
The problem on my side was, that some OPCUA servers like Kepware allow the Node Identifier contain spaces, brackets and such stuff. With some of this elements Matlab is not happy overall so the error occurs. In your case maybe the curly brackets {} are the problem.
